Arrests after two teenagers injured in stabbing

Two teenagers have been arrested after two youths were seriously injured in a stabbing in Leeds.
Police were called to Monet Close in Chapel Allerton at about 13:40 BST on Thursday following reports of males carrying weapons in the area.
The ambulance service treated two youths with serious but not life-threatening stab injuries, with both taken to hospital.
Two 16-year-old boys were arrested on suspicion of affray and remain in custody, West Yorkshire Police said.
A scene remains in place in the suburb while investigations continue.
Officers appealed for witnesses or anyone with information to get in touch.
